Easy Jenn Air Electric Cooktop Removal Guide

how to remove jenn air electric cooktop

Removing a Jenn Air electric cooktop requires careful attention to safety. First, turn off the breakers for the stove and unplug it from underneath the cooktop. If it is hardwired, turn off the breaker and undo the wiring. Look for clamps on each side of the cooktop and remove them. Place your hands on the sides of the cooktop and push up to remove it. To reinstall, simply reverse the process.

Remove the junction box cover and unscrew the wire nuts

Before starting work on any electrical appliance, it is crucial to prioritise safety. Working with live wires can lead to serious injury or even fatal accidents. So, before you begin, locate your home's circuit breaker and switch off the power for the circuit connected to the junction box. Use a voltage tester to confirm that the power is off.

Now, locate the junction box where the wiring from the Jenn-Air range top is connected. You will need to use a screwdriver to remove the junction box cover. Inspect the screw type; flathead screws require a flat blade, while Phillips screws need a cross-tip. If the screws are rusted or unusually tight, consider using a Dremel tool with a cutting wheel to create a notch in the screw head. This method will allow you to turn stubborn screws without damaging the junction box.

Once the cover is removed, you will see the wires. Identify the hot wires (typically black or red), neutral wires (white), and any ground wires (bare or green). Now, carefully untwist the wire nuts and pull the wires apart. It is important to always grip the wires firmly but gently to avoid damage.

After removing the wire nuts and separating the wires, you can proceed to the next steps of removing the Jenn-Air electric cooktop.

Loosen clamps on the underside holding the cooktop in place

To loosen the clamps holding your Jenn Air electric cooktop in place, you will first need to turn off the electricity at the circuit breaker. This is an essential safety step to ensure that there is no power going to the cooktop during the removal process.

Once the power is off, you will need to locate the clamps on the underside of the cooktop. These clamps are typically found on each side of the cooktop and hold it firmly in position. Using a screwdriver or a wrench, begin to loosen the clamps by turning them in a counter-clockwise direction. If the clamps are especially tight, you may need to apply some force or use an appropriate tool to gain leverage.

In some cases, the clamps may be difficult to access or located in a confined space. If this is the case, you may need to use a tool with a long reach, such as an extra-long bit holder, to reach the clamps and loosen them effectively. It is important to work carefully and patiently during this process to avoid damaging the cooktop or the surrounding countertop.

If your cooktop is held in place with screws instead of clamps, you will need to use a screwdriver or a wrench to loosen and remove them. Some cooktops may even have a combination of both clamps and screws, so be sure to inspect your cooktop thoroughly and address all fasteners accordingly.

Once all the clamps and/or screws have been sufficiently loosened, you can then proceed with carefully lifting and removing the cooktop from its position. It is recommended to have an assistant help with this step to ensure the cooktop is safely and securely handled.

You may consider a standard glass cooktop, an induction cooktop, or a regular hood. While Jenn-Air is a well-known brand for downdraft vented electric cooktops, some people find that downdraft venting is ineffective and not worth the money.

Downdraft venting can be ineffective at capturing smoke, steam, and oil splashes, leading to an unpleasant cooking experience. Additionally, island mount hoods can be challenging to find and may require modifications to your countertop.
